请选择 进入手机版 | 继续访问电脑版

翼讯科技帮助论坛

 找回密码
 立即注册
搜索
热搜: 活动 交友 discuz
查看: 1517|回复: 0

MySQL #1364 – Field “ ” doesn’t have a default value

[复制链接]

22

主题

23

帖子

176

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
176
发表于 2016-6-3 17:53:05 | 显示全部楼层 |阅读模式
mysql 字段已经设置了默认值,但是执行sql语句的时候,还是会报#1364 – Field “ ” doesn’t have a default value,提示该值没有默认值。

配置my.ini(my.cnf),去掉:STRICT_TRANS_TABLES  重新启动mysql服务
my.ini配置代码
# Set the SQL mode to strict
# sql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"
sql-mode="N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ION"
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Archiver|手机版|小黑屋|翼讯科技帮助论坛

GMT+8, 2019-10-21 01:20 , Processed in 0.234722 second(s), 24 queries .

Powered by Discuz! X3

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表